Transaction 21c6b27dfae5afd880bac14f07c7ddca760224a0d26a844e8067afd4ae7154b6
1 Input
1 Output
-
21c6b27dfae5afd880bac14f07c7ddca760224a0d26a844e8067afd4ae7154b6:0
- value
- 7602789
- script pubkey
- OP_0 OP_PUSHBYTES_20 59a01e065345b4b9074f5a9d923ebe693ff21137
- address
- bc1qtxspupjngk6tjp60t2wey047dyllyyfhj2rhaw